Historical Context: From Passive Consumption to Interactive Engagement
Initially, online gaming was characterized by simple browser games and multiplayer environments focused on entertainment and social interaction. Titles like FarmVille and early MMORPGs created communities but kept monetization primarily restricted to advertising and in-game purchases.
However, as broadband connectivity improved and smartphones became ubiquitous, the industry expanded rapidly. The advent of live multiplayer experiences, eSports, and streaming platforms began hinting at the potential for gaming to serve as both entertainment and livelihood.
The Rise of Gaming as a Revenue-Generating Avenue
Today, the concept of earning through gaming is well-established in various forms:
- eSports: Competitive gaming tournaments with multimillion-pound prize pools draw vast audiences and offer lucrative opportunities for top players.
- Content Creation: Streamers and YouTubers monetize their gaming sessions, sponsorships, and viewer support.
- Online Casinos and Betting: Digital platforms allow players to wager on casino games, sports, and virtual events.
- Skill-Based Gaming Platforms: New models enable players to showcase skill and potentially win real money, inspiring initiatives that integrate gaming with financial incentives.
Legitimacy and Regulation: Ensuring Fair Play
| Factor | Description | Impact on Credibility |
|---|---|---|
| Licensing & Regulation | Platforms must comply with UKGC (United Kingdom Gambling Commission) standards | High: Establishes trust and fairness |
| Game Fairness & RNG Certification | Random number generator (RNG) integrity assurances | Essential: Guarantees unbiased outcomes |
| User Security & Data Privacy | Implementation of GDPR and secure payment processing | Critical: Safeguards players’ information and funds |
